“Mother Tongue” by SlapDee, featuring the late and beloved Daev Zambia, is a deeply resonant and introspective song that blends cultural pride, identity, and lyrical excellence into a powerful Afro-hip-hop anthem.

As the title suggests, the track is a tribute to one’s native language — a metaphor for authenticity, origin, and the unbreakable bond with one’s roots. SlapDee delivers reflective verses with precision and emotional depth, speaking about the importance of staying true to who you are in a world that constantly tries to dilute culture and values. His flow is commanding, his bars packed with meaning, as he raps in both English and local dialects — a direct nod to the significance of embracing one’s heritage unapologetically. The late Daev Zambia, whose legacy continues to shine through his music, blesses the track with a soulful and hauntingly beautiful chorus. “Mother Tongue” is more than just a song — it’s a cultural statement and a heartfelt tribute to language, roots, and identity.
